二二下载网为您提供一个绿色下载空间!
当前位置: 首页 > 二二资讯

as游戏开发,入门指南与实战技巧

来源:小编 更新:2024-10-15 08:31:23

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

AS游戏开发:入门指南与实战技巧

随着移动互联网的快速发展,游戏行业呈现出蓬勃生机。ActionScript(AS)作为Adobe Flash平台的主要编程语言,曾一度是网页游戏开发的热门选择。本文将为您介绍AS游戏开发的入门知识,并提供一些实战技巧,帮助您快速上手。

一、AS游戏开发简介

AS游戏开发是指使用ActionScript语言在Adobe Flash平台上进行游戏开发。Flash平台具有跨平台、易于上手、资源丰富等特点,使得AS游戏开发在一段时间内成为网页游戏开发的主流。

二、AS游戏开发环境搭建

1. 安装Adobe Flash Builder:Flash Builder是Adobe官方提供的集成开发环境(IDE),支持AS游戏开发。下载并安装Flash Builder后,即可开始AS游戏开发之旅。

2. 安装Flash Player:Flash Player是运行Flash应用程序的必要插件。在浏览器中打开Flash游戏时,需要安装Flash Player。

3. 安装相关库和插件:为了方便开发,可以安装一些常用的库和插件,如Egret Engine、LayaAir等。这些库和插件提供了丰富的游戏开发功能,可以大大提高开发效率。

三、AS游戏开发入门教程

1. 学习ActionScript基础:ActionScript是一种面向对象的编程语言,学习AS游戏开发前,需要掌握ActionScript的基础语法、数据类型、控制结构等。

2. 学习Flash界面设计:Flash界面设计是AS游戏开发的基础,需要掌握Flash的绘图工具、元件、图层等概念。

3. 学习游戏开发流程:了解游戏开发的基本流程,包括需求分析、设计、开发、测试、发布等环节。

4. 学习常用游戏开发库:掌握Egret Engine、LayaAir等常用游戏开发库的使用方法,提高开发效率。

四、AS游戏开发实战技巧

1. 优化性能:在AS游戏开发过程中,性能优化至关重要。可以通过以下方法提高游戏性能:

(1)合理使用变量:避免在循环中创建大量临时变量,减少内存占用。

(2)优化代码结构:合理组织代码,减少重复代码,提高代码可读性和可维护性。

(3)使用位图精灵:使用位图精灵代替矢量图形,提高渲染速度。

2. 精细化设计:在游戏设计方面,注重细节,提高用户体验。

(1)界面设计:简洁、美观、易用。

(2)音效和音乐:选择合适的音效和音乐,增强游戏氛围。

(3)关卡设计:合理设置关卡难度,提高游戏可玩性。

3. 跨平台开发:利用Flash平台的跨平台特性,实现游戏在多个平台上运行。

AS游戏开发具有跨平台、易于上手、资源丰富等特点,是游戏开发者的理想选择。通过本文的介绍,相信您已经对AS游戏开发有了初步的了解。在实际开发过程中,不断学习、积累经验,才能成为一名优秀的AS游戏开发者。


玩家评论

此处添加你的第三方评论代码
Copyright © 2018-2024 二二下载网 版权所有